DESIGNER: Giorgetto Giugiaro
Bertone was commissioned to "clothe" these dimensions in a more modern shape that would, however, still show its ties to the Giulia; this is evident especially in the shape of the roof. Giugiaro, who followed the development of the 1750 up to the construction of the styling model, designed a smooth side characterized by a thin ribbing that starts at the rear wheel arch and straightens out above. The front and back views are simple and uncluttered. The grille, with double circular headlights of the same diameter, recalls the design of the Giulia Sport Special. Neither the engine hood nor the trunk has any decorative frills. After his first two Mazda attempts, Giugiaro made a brilliant show of the three-box four-door sedan theme with the 1750. And did so with a very modern and elegant sedan, so devoid of decorative motifs that it foreshadowed the idea of reduced-to-a-minimum shapes that was to culminate in the FIAT Uno.
